Bajaj Auto Bets On Electric Bikes; Targets FY28 Launch For International Markets

Bajaj Auto is ramping up its electric vehicle (EV) ambitions, planning to launch its first electric bikes in international markets by FY28. The company aims to leverage its existing manufacturing prowess and global distribution network to compete in the fast-growing EV space.
This move is significant for investors as it diversifies Bajaj Auto's revenue streams beyond its traditional petrol-powered two-wheelers. The company has already demonstrated strong operational efficiency in its EV segment, achieving double-digit Ebitda margins. This suggests the new models could be highly profitable, potentially boosting the parent company's overall financial performance.
Investors should watch for updates on the specific models planned for export and the timeline for domestic launches. Success in international markets will be a key indicator of the company's ability to execute its EV strategy and capture market share.
